Bryan Ryley is a Canadian artist[1][2] and educator based in Vernon, British Columbia.
Educated at the University of Victoria and the Pratt Institute in Brooklyn, Ryley is currently an Associate Professor[3] of Fine Arts at the University of British Columbia Okanagan.
Throughout his artistic career, Bryan Ryley's work moves back and forth among three media – painting, drawing, and collage.
Ryley exhibits in both Canada and The United States.
His work is found in numerous private and public collections, such as, The Canada Council Art Bank, Ottawa; Kelowna Public Art Gallery, Kelowna; Vernon Public Art Gallery; The Pratt Institute in Brooklyn, New York; Petro Canada Collection; Shell Collection in Calgary, Alberta.
